CHAPTER 24 Sudden Turn Of Events


Luna decided to spend her vacation with her father. Well, for some teenagers, they would label it as 'the most horrible vacation ever', but for Luna, every day spent with her father was a memory worth keeping for.

She stared distractingly to the spoon inside her cup that was full of hot chocolate. With her head rested to her palm, and eyes blank, her father squinted his eyes curiously at his troubled daughter, curious because he had never seen her so puzzled. Slowly, he grabbed his own cup from the table and made his way to sit next to Luna, where he patted his daughter's head just like how he always do when she was distracted and he needed her attention.

"Oh hi Daddy" she turned her head to look at him, a childish smile formed on her face as she met face to face with her father. He smiled back, cupping her cheek inside his hand to smoothen his daughter's skin.

"What's troubling you, love?" their bond was close and he knows when she was hiding something from him. He also knew that everday, time is running, he was getting older and so was his daughter. "Nothing, Daddy. Must've been the wrackspurts" she said, turning her head to stop her eyes from looking straight to his own blue orbs. A small smile formed on his lips as he analyzes what was currently happening.

He watched her as she grew up. He tried to shield his daughter from the reality, he fears that she might not handle it, he didn't want her to expirience struggles. But then, when Berenice died, Luna proved him wrong; actually, she was stronger than he was. He was once broken and damaged, but he grew strong for his daughter, because his daughter was strong and she needed to know that she was not alone.

"Tell me" he grabbed her hand, encouraging her to continue.

"It's about a boy" she leaned side-viewed inside her arms, then added "was it wrong that I still love him?"

In truth, he was shocked to hear his daughter say those things. It only proves that she was not the same seven year old anymore, his little angel grew into a woman. And now, she was experiencing one of the most beautiful thing in life; falling inlove. Somehow, he hopes she would do okay with that topic. It was the trickiest thing to experience, being inlove is beautiful and wonderful but being broken is a different thing.

"Well, Luna dear- nobody said love is easy."


It was March 1, Ronald's birthday and they have this little surprise for him for the evening. The Gryffindor table was filled with all of the goodies Ron ever wanted in one seat. Besides from the goodies, the presents were all lined up inside the dormitory, assisted by Harry.

Apparently, the boy did enjoyed his meal. Mostly the bucket of chicken that he had eaten, and maybe, the sucking faces that he had shared with Lavender Brown.

After the few exchanges of happy birthday's and chit chat's finally, Ron called it a night. Harry, Hermione, Ginny, Fred, George, Neville, and Ron went to their dormitories, wanting to open the gifts that he had received. But then, Luna, being a Ravenclaw, was left behind. She didn't mind though, since they would probably talk about the gifts tomorrow, and that, she can already imagine their happy faces and jokes that the twins would share.

She sighed happily and made her way to the Library, wanting to gain some quiet time with her book.

As she sat herself to the Restricted Section of the room, she opened her copy of Alice and the Wonderland. The pages were opened and her eyes were on it, but then the book reminds her about something-

"Can I share the table with you?" she heard a man's voice say,somehow, the sound of the voice sent numerous of sparks on her tummy.

"It's alright" she replied back to the familiar voice, trying to shrug the feeling out.

"I can't go back to yesterday because I was a different person then." she voiced out the quote that she seems to read over and over again. She wasn't paying much attention to what she was actually reading. She had already read the book five times now, but then, she needed a distraction, a way to forget about him.

"But what if the past is worth bringing back?" Luna paused. She closed the book and setted it to the table, her lower lip was bitten by her upper front teeth. "It depends i-"she stopped talking as she saw who was the mysterious man on the table, and strangely the man wasn't so surprised to see her at all.

Draco was still waiting for her to reply, his eyes staring on hers. She opened her mouth to speak, although she can't seem to find her voice. He stood up from his seat, he can't help the small hint of tears on the side of his eyelids. Luna tilted her head slowly, never leaving eye contact with him. There was a pregnant pause and then, Luna seem to register what was happening. She stood up, bowing her head to gather all her things, wanting to leave just to get away from him "Luna, I-" he grabbed her shoulder, turning her head to tilt upwards towards him. Their eyes collided to one other and Draco licked his lips as he bowed his head lower to hers.

He crouched his head and their foreheads collided. Slowly, he also leaned his head and their lips made contact.

She went frozen on her spot,the strange realization of founding herself not wanting to back away from him. Instead, she tiptoed her toes and closed her eyes, leaning in a bit deeper to taste and smell him once again.

"Luna, something happened to Ro-" just like that, they broke apart. Both of them eyes wide and looking at their intruder. "I-I'll come with you" Luna hugged her book deeper in her chest and brisk walked to Ginny, clearly not wanting to look at Draco, too shocked about the sudden turn of events. But them, like them, Ginny was also looking as shocked as they were.
